- Trading
- In order to engage in a Trade (as defined below) you must first transfer Digital Assets that are supported by the Services to your CBX Account. The Services associated with your CBX Account include a wallet service provided by CBX (“CBX Wallet”). The CBX Wallet will permit you to generate one or more addresses to which Digital Assets may be transferred from an account, wallet or address not hosted or controlled by CBX (“External Account”).
- A “Trade” is an exchange of Digital Assets for which trading is supported on the Services between you and another user of the Services whereby you dispose of certain Digital Assets and acquire different Digital Assets. You may at your discretion transfer from an External Account to your CBX Wallet any Digital Assets that are supported for transfer and storage using the Services. If you transfer to your CBX Wallet any Digital Assets that are not supported by the Services, such Digital Assets may be permanently lost.
- You are required to retain in your CBX Wallet a sufficient quantity of Digital Assets necessary to satisfy any open orders (and applicable service fees). You agree that there may be limits on the amounts that you are able to withdraw on a daily or other periodic basis. Otherwise, you may at your discretion withdraw Digital Assets from your CBX Wallet to an External Account provided that the service fee is charged.
- CBX is not able to reverse any transfers and will not have any responsibility or liability if you have instructed CBX to send Digital Assets to an address that is incorrect, improperly formatted, erroneous or intended for a different type of Digital Assets. The timing for completing any transfer will depend on third party actions that are outside the control of CBX and CBX makes no guarantee regarding the amount of time it may take to complete any transfer. CBX may impose limits on the amount of any inbound or outbound transfers or suspend or terminate the ability to transfer Digital Assets into or out of your CBX Wallet in order to comply with all Applicable Law, an order from law enforcement or other governmental authority, or otherwise at CBX’s discretion.
- An “Order” is created when you enter an instruction to affect a Trade using the Services. When you enter an Order you authorize CBX to execute a Trade on a spot basis for all or a portion of the number of Digital Assets specified in your Order in accordance with such Order. Upon placement of an Order, your CBX Account will be updated to reflect the open Order and your Order will be included on the CBX Platform for matching with Orders from other users. If all or a portion of your Order is matched with another user, a Trade will be executed. Upon execution of a Trade, your CBX Account will be updated to reflect that the Order has either been closed due to having been fully executed or updated to reflect any partial fulfilment of the Order. Orders will remain open until fully executed or cancelled in accordance with Section 3.2 (f) below. For purposes of effectuating a Trade, you authorize CBX to take temporary custody of the Digital Assets that you are disposing of in the Trade.
- You may only cancel an Order initiated via the Services if such cancellation occurs before your Order has been matched with an order from another user. Once your Order has been matched with an order from another user, you may not change, withdraw, or cancel your authorization for CBX to complete such Order. If any Order has been partially matched, you may cancel the unmatched portion of the Order unless and until the unmatched portion has been matched. CBX reserves the right to refuse any cancellation request associated with an Order after you have submitted such Order.
- If you have an insufficient amount of Digital Assets in your CBX Wallet to fulfil an Order, CBX may cancel the entire Order or may fulfil a partial Order that can be covered by the Digital Assets in your CBX Wallet (after deducting any fees payable in connection with the Trade).
